LPG Pipeline Installation Process: 7 Steps from Survey to Safety Commissioning
Upgrading your home with a fixed Residential LPG Pipeline is a significant investment in safety and convenience. While the final result is seamless, the installation is a detailed, multi-step professional process designed to ensure maximum integrity and compliance.
Understanding the sequence helps manage expectations and confirms that every component, from the Outdoor Gas Cage to the final appliance valve, is installed to the highest safety standards.
Here is the step-by-step process of installing an LPG Pipeline in your home, executed by a certified professional team.
Phase 1: Planning and Preparation (The Design Stage)
The process begins with meticulous planning, where safety and efficient routing are prioritized over everything else.
Step 1: The Site Survey and Personalized Design
A certified technician will visit your home to conduct a thorough site assessment. This involves:
- Measuring the exact distance from the chosen Outdoor Gas Cage location to the kitchen.
- Identifying the safest and most efficient routing (surface or concealed).
- Determining the required pipe size based on the number of appliances (cooktops, water heaters, etc.).
- Assessing structural factors that might affect installation complexity.
Step 2: Material and Design Finalization
Based on the survey, you and the technician will finalize the design and materials. This includes:
- Choosing the piping material (Copper Pipe or Jindal MLC Pipe).
- Selecting the appropriate Pressure Regulator and automatic changeover unit (for uninterrupted supply).
- Agreeing on the placement of all final appliance points and emergency shut-off valves.
Phase 2: Installation and Piping (The Build Stage)
Once the design is approved, the physical installation begins. This is where the fixed, leak-proof system is constructed.
Step 3: Setting Up the Outdoor Gas Cage and Regulator
The foundation of the system is installed outside your home:
- A secured, ventilated Outdoor Gas Cage is mounted on a solid surface, far from ignition sources.
- The gas cylinders are placed inside and connected to the main Pressure Regulator and the primary shut-off valve.
Step 4: Routing the Pipeline (The Main Line)
The piping material is run from the regulator to the kitchen:
- External Line: Pipes are run along the wall, securely fixed with clamps, or buried underground (if needed, using protective sleeves).
- Internal Line: Pipes are routed discreetly into the kitchen, often concealed within walls or false ceilings for a clean aesthetic.
- Joint Security: If using Copper, joints are permanently sealed using high-temperature brazing. If using MLC, specialized EZ-Fit compression fittings are used to guarantee a reliable, mechanical seal.
Step 5: Installing Valves and Appliance Connections
The final connection points are created inside the kitchen:
- Isolation Valves: A dedicated Emergency Shut-off Valve is installed near the appliance connection point for quick isolation.
- Appliance Connection: The fixed pipeline ends at the appliance point, ready to be connected to your cooktop or other gas appliance using a short, high-grade flexible hose.
Phase 3: Testing and Commissioning (The Safety Stage)
This phase is the most critical and non-negotiable step, guaranteeing the integrity of the installation.
Step 6: Mandatory Pressure Testing
After all piping is complete but before gas is introduced, the entire line is subjected to rigorous pressure testing:
- The system is pressurized with inert gas (like air or nitrogen) far above the normal operating pressure.
- The pressure is monitored over a set period. Any drop in pressure indicates a leak, ensuring the technician must immediately locate and fix the issue before moving forward.
- This step guarantees every joint and fitting is perfectly secure and leak-proof.
Step 7: Final Commissioning and Handover
Once the system passes the pressure test with zero deviation, it is ready for use:
- The LPG is introduced into the line, and the regulator is activated.
- The technician checks every connection again using leak detection fluid.
- The customer is trained on the use of the main regulator, the emergency shut-off valves, and the procedure for cylinder changeover.
- You receive the final Safety Certification and warranty documents, marking the completion of your safe, new gas pipeline system.

LPG Pipeline Installation Process FAQs (Timeline & Logistics)
These FAQs address logistical concerns and reinforce the crucial safety steps involved in installing a Residential LPG Pipeline, complementing the step-by-step guide.
1. How long does the entire LPG Pipeline Installation Process typically take?
The installation timeline varies based on complexity:
- Initial Survey & Quote: 1-2 days.
- Simple Surface Installation: 1 to 2 working days.
- Complex/Concealed Installation: 2 to 4 working days, depending on wall preparation and restoration time.
The most time-consuming part is often the meticulous routing and the mandatory, non-negotiable final pressure testing, which ensures long-lasting safety.
2. How disruptive is the installation process, especially if I choose concealed piping?
A professional team strives to minimize disruption. For surface routing, disruption is minimal. For concealed piping, the process involves carefully cutting small channels into the wall for the pipes. While this involves dust and some noise, the installer typically schedules the piping and then allows for necessary civil work (like plastering and painting) to restore the aesthetic, ensuring a clean finish.
3. Why is the Mandatory Pressure Testing step so critical?
Mandatory Pressure Testing is the single most important safety check. During this step, the pipeline is pressurized far above its normal operating level. This test guarantees that every brazed joint (for Copper) or every EZ-Fit compression fitting (for MLC) is perfectly secure and leak-proof before any LPG is introduced into the system, validating the entire LPG Pipeline Installation Process.
4. When is the piping material (Copper or MLC) decided in the installation process?
The piping material choice is finalized during Step 2: Material and Design Finalization, immediately following the site survey. This decision directly impacts the tools, labor required (brazing vs. fittings), and the installation cost, making it an essential early decision in the Residential LPG Installation Timeline.
5. What do I, as the homeowner, need to do during the installation process?
Your involvement is minimal once the design is set:
- Provide Access: Ensure technicians have easy access to the cylinder location and all routing points.
- Approve Routing: Verify the pipe routes before any major work begins.
- Final Check: Be present for the Final Commissioning and Handover (Step 7) to learn how to operate the regulator and use the emergency shut-off valves.
6. What is the Final Commissioning and Handover, and what documentation will I receive?
This is the final step where the system is officially made operational. You will receive:
- Safety Certification: Documentation certifying the line passed the pressure test and complies with all industry standards.
- Warranty Certificate: Covering materials and workmanship.
- Operational Training: Instruction on managing your cylinders and using all safety components of the Home Gas Line System.
